Introduction to Aluminum Brake Boosters

Aluminum brake boosters are essential components in modern hydraulic braking systems, designed to reduce the effort required by drivers to bring vehicles to a halt. These devices leverage engine vacuum or auxiliary pumps to amplify the force applied to the brake pedal, thereby enhancing the overall efficiency of the braking process.

Types and Mechanisms

The variety of aluminum brake boosters available on the market includes active and conventional models. Active boosters distinguish themselves by utilizing a solenoid to operate the air valve, directly influencing the master cylinder's pressure. The conventional counterparts rely on the physical force exerted by the driver. Within these categories, boosters may feature single or tandem diaphragms, with the latter being prevalent in larger vehicles such as trucks due to their increased force multiplication capabilities.

Design and Functionality

Aluminum brake boosters are designed to be lightweight yet robust, contributing to their functionality without adding unnecessary weight to the vehicle. They come in two primary designs based on air intake methods: cabin-breathers and engine-breathers. The majority of these boosters harness vacuum power from the engine intake, utilizing it to augment the force exerted on the master cylinder by the brake pedal. This process significantly increases the hydraulic pressure within the brakes, facilitating a more responsive braking system.

Applications and Advantages

These boosters are universally employed in vehicles equipped with hydraulic brakes, excluding those that use alternative braking systems such as cables, pressurized air, or rods. The role of an aluminum brake booster becomes particularly crucial under conditions of low engine vacuum, where additional force is necessary to maintain effective braking performance. The use of aluminum as a material offers the advantage of corrosion resistance and longevity, ensuring that the booster remains functional over extended periods of use.

Selection Considerations

When selecting an aluminum brake booster, it is important to consider the specific requirements of the vehicle, including size, type of diaphragm, and air intake method. Compatibility with the existing braking system is paramount to ensure that the booster provides the intended enhancement to brake performance. It is also essential to consider the environmental conditions in which the vehicle operates, as this can influence the choice between cabin-breather and engine-breather models.
